Understanding the Importance of Stable Internet for Gaming
A stable internet connection is crucial for gaming because it directly impacts your gameplay experience. Lag, packet loss, and high ping can turn a thrilling game into a frustrating one. According to a survey by the Internet Society, 70% of gamers report that a stable internet connection is the most important factor in their gaming experience. Let’s break down why this is so important:
- Reduced Lag: A stable internet connection minimizes lag, ensuring that your actions in the game are reflected in real-time. This is particularly important in fast-paced games like first-person shooters.
- Lower Ping: Ping is the time it takes for data to travel from your device to the game server and back. A stable connection keeps your ping low, ensuring smoother gameplay.
- Reliable Performance: A stable internet connection ensures that you don’t experience sudden drops in performance, which can be the difference between winning and losing in competitive gaming.
Optimizing Your Internet Connection for Gaming
Optimizing your internet connection involves several steps, from choosing the right type of connection to configuring your router settings. Here are some practical tips to ensure your gaming setup has a stable internet connection:
- Choose the Right Internet Plan: Opt for a plan with a high upload and download speed. Fiber-optic connections are ideal as they offer the fastest and most stable internet. According to a report by the Federal Communications Commission, fiber-optic connections have an average latency of 10-20 milliseconds, which is significantly lower than other types of connections.
- Configure Your Router: Place your router in a central location to ensure optimal signal strength. Disable features like Quality of Service (QoS) that can interfere with gaming performance. Many routers have a “gaming mode” that prioritizes gaming traffic, which can be beneficial.
- Use Wired Connections: If possible, use an Ethernet cable to connect your gaming device directly to your router. Wired connections are more stable and less prone to interference than wireless connections.

Frequently Asked Questions
How can I improve my internet speed for gaming?
To improve your internet speed for gaming, consider upgrading to a fiber-optic connection, using an Ethernet cable instead of Wi-Fi, and optimizing your router settings. Additionally, using a gaming router can further enhance your gaming experience by prioritizing gaming traffic.
What is the best internet speed for gaming?
The ideal internet speed for gaming is a minimum of 10 Mbps download and 1 Mbps upload. However, for the best experience, aim for at least 25 Mbps download and 3 Mbps upload. This ensures that you have a stable and fast connection, reducing lag and improving overall performance.
How do I configure my router for gaming?
To configure your router for gaming, place it in a central location, disable unnecessary features, and enable QoS settings to prioritize gaming traffic. Additionally, consider using a gaming router that is specifically designed to optimize gaming performance.
Is a wired connection better than a wireless one for gaming?
Yes, a wired connection is generally better than a wireless one for gaming. Wired connections are more stable and less prone to interference, providing a more consistent and reliable gaming experience. However, if a wired connection is not possible, ensure your wireless connection is optimized for gaming.
